flauschig

German

Etymology

From Flausch + -ig.

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/ˈflaʊ̯ʃɪç/ (standard)
  • IPA(key): /ˈflaʊ̯ʃɪk/ (common form in southern Germany, Austria, and Switzerland)
  • (file)
  • Hyphenation: flau‧schig

Adjective

flauschig (strong nominative masculine singular flauschiger, comparative flauschiger, superlative am flauschigsten)

  1. fluffy, pillowy
